Gartner 还预测,在疫情期间远程开发的激增将继续推动低代码的采用,尽管削减了预算并努力优化了成本。
低代码早已不再是新鲜的概念。从简单的仪表板到复杂的应用程序,低代码应用程序正变得越来越多样化,并在企业界得到了广泛的采用。从本质上讲,低代码是应用程序开发的一种可视化范例,它涉及拖放预构建的组件和集成,从而实现了快速,轻松且不易出错的开发。
低代码的优势在于,它使非传统开发背景的用户能够参与应用程序开发过程,从而降低开发门槛并加快项目进度。随着组织在资源有限和开发人员稀缺的情况下满足不断增长的数字化需求,这也缩小了供需缺口。与传统的开发范式相比,低代码平台的出现使泛开发人员(例如业务分析师,业务线用户,初级开发人员)易于构建应用程序,同时大大缩短了交付时间。
但是,为泛开发人员提供的生产力和速度并不是低代码开发的唯一好处。如今,低代码开发平台还具有专门为从企业 IT 团队到 ISV 的专业开发人员而构建的功能。这些平台经过强化,可用于企业用途,能够利用复杂应用程序的可伸缩性和安全性需求,并且具有足够成熟的集成功能,可以无缝地与现有工具和技术配合使用。
在疫情爆发期间,许多企业通过采用低代码平台和应用程序进行了重塑,从而帮助他们适应了突然转移到远程工作场景并满足随之而来的必要现代应用程序需求。
与传统开发相比,低代码涉及各种角色,共同构建应用程序,同时处理自动生成的代码、现成的组件和内置的默认配置。环境的这种变化揭示了一些需要解决的独特挑战。建立在低代码上的远程团队面临一些常见的安全挑战。
随着企业和 ISV 在更重要的业务中转向低代码,更大的问题仍然存在。低代码平台是否可以使现代开发团队更快地交付应用程序,同时仍能实现安全且严格控制的环境?答案是,是的,他们可以!但是,开发团队在考虑低代码平台时必须考虑以下安全检查表:1、所选的低代码平台必须在企业安全的 DMZ 或安全的私有云中建立,并且必须毫不费力地通过网络安全许可。
2、该平台必须对自动生成的代码以及开发人员编写的自定义代码实施最佳的编程实践(编码约
定,设计模式和数据加密),以简化与现有 CI/CD 流程和工具的集成。
3、该平台必须针对 Web 和移动应用程序的十大 OWASP 漏洞提供全面保护,并拥有第三方认证以保证代码质量和安全性。此外,组织应确保所选平台的二进制文件以及 CVE 库中列出的所有第三方依赖项(包括开源库)中均不存在漏洞。
4、该解决方案必须支持多个身份验证提供程序(数据库,LDAP,AD,SSO,SAML,Open-ID,多因素,生物识别),以构建具有强大用户安全性的应用程序。对于用户授权,请确保同时支持粗粒度访问控制策略和细粒度访问控制策略,以保护基于 RBAC 的应用程序的各个方面。
开发团队可以采用低代码技术,同时确保适当的安全最佳实践。低代码将保留下来,并且借助正确的平台,企业和 ISV 可以确保在开发过程的早期就将安全性向左转移并由开发人员解决。结果是高效率的远程劳动力生产出了现代,可扩展和安全的应用程序。
本文标题:低代码开发会带来安全风险吗?
转载来源:http://www.csdahua.cn/qtweb/news20/350070.html
网站建设、网络推广公司-快上网,是专注品牌与效果的网站制作,网络营销seo公司;服务项目有等
声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 快上网